HTML <input> accepteer Attribuut
Voorbeeld
Specificeer welke bestandstypen de gebruiker kan kiezen in het dialoogvenster voor bestandsinvoer:
<form action="/action_page.php">
<label for="img">Select image:</label>
<input type="file" id="img"
name="img" accept="image/*">
<input type="submit">
</form>
Definitie en gebruik
Het accept
attribuut specificeert een filter voor welke bestandstypes de gebruiker kan kiezen in het bestandsinvoerdialoogvenster.
Opmerking: het accept
attribuut kan alleen worden gebruikt met
<input type="file">
.
Tip: Gebruik dit kenmerk niet als validatietool. Bestandsuploads moeten worden gevalideerd op de server.
Browserondersteuning
De getallen in de tabel geven de eerste browserversie aan die het kenmerk volledig ondersteunt.
Attribute | |||||
---|---|---|---|---|---|
accept | 26.0 | 10.0 | 37.0 | 11.1 | 15.0 |
Syntaxis
<input accept="file_extension|audio/*|video/*|image/*|media_type">
Tip: Als u meer dan één waarde wilt opgeven, scheidt u de waarden met een komma (bijv <input accept="audio/*,video/*,image/*" />
.
Attribuutwaarden
Value | Description |
---|---|
file_extension | Specify the file extension(s) (e.g: .gif, .jpg, .png, .doc) the user can pick from |
audio/* | The user can pick all sound files |
video/* | The user can pick all video files |
image/* | The user can pick all image files |
media_type | A valid media type, with no parameters. Look at IANA Media Types for a complete list of standard media types |
❮ HTML <input>-tag